the Articles of Confederation Congress couldn't raise an army because it had no power to a. Raise an army b. tax c. borrow d. appoint officers

The Articles of Confederation Congress couldn't raise an army because it had no power to "tax", since this weakness was intentionally created by the Founding Fathers to ensure that the central government wouldn't become too powerful.
